Record all of your car accidents

It is very handy to keep records, but to record an accident as it happens is something completely different. This is from Japan and although at first you think why would you want to do that, it is only when you have an accident do you really need something like this.

You think that you are prepared for any occurrence, but when it actually happens all those plans are forgotten and then so are all the details etc, this means that you could possibly lose any claim four damages, which could cost you thousands of dollars.
Priced at around $412, which is not bad at all.

Computer Controlled Intelligent Scarecrow?

Click Here to View in Full Screen Mode
Yes, it has been done by students from University of South Florida. Great job guys! These guys should really make a new start-up company making whole bunch of these for farmers…
Our idea for this project was to develop an “intelligent scarecrow” called the Erebus Scarecrow. The system is designed to protect ponds at a fish farm from bird predators that can cost farmers thousands of dollars in losses. The Erebus Scarecrow helps the environment by introducing an effective non-lethal method of pest deterrence to protect the birds and to prevent the spread of disease and contamination of the raised fish.
As a requirement for the Windows Challenge, our environment of development was Windows CE 5.0. We were provided an eBox II with Windows CE and tools to develop for it after being accepted as one of the top 200 teams worldwide. I was in charge of everything Windows CE related, from creating the custom operating system image with Platform Builder 5.0 to deploying and debugging our application with Visual Studio 2005.
